Fitz didn't waste his time at Harvard.  He's probably the smartest QB of his generation.  He's articulate, charming, and down to earth.  I remember reading that when he was living in the Buffalo area, he used to mow his own lawn.  Now there might be other players who do that, but I'm doubting many people making QB money do.

 

I wish he had a little more talent.  He had a Brett Favre attacking style but not Favre's arm.  With a little more throwing ability he could have been HOF worthy.  As it was he was a journeyman who the really good teams wouldn't hire, so he settled for making mediocre teams better.
